2020-08-24mate*: remove unintentional linkage against pkgsrc gettext-libsgutteridge1-2/+2
As of 1.24, MATE requires GNU-specific msgfmt features. meta-pkgs/mate/ Makefile.common r. 1.10 expressed this tool dependency using USE_BUILTIN.gettext=no, but this exposed pkgsrc gettext-libs in the build environment as well, which some MATE packages then linked against, but gettext-libs didn't end up being declared as a run-time dependency, so binary package installations were broken (with the workaround of manually installing the undeclared gettext-libs dependency). Express this dependency differently, so GNU msgfmt is used as a tool without exposing pkgsrc gettext-libs. (The pkgsrc tooling infrastruture could be altered to provide a distinct "gmsgfmt" tool, same with "gxgettext", and perhaps others. Here I'm just immediately concerned with fixing this packaging issue.) Addresses PR pkg/55503 by Jay Patel.
2020-08-23nano: update to 5.1wiedi3-16/+18
2020.08.12 - GNU nano 5.1 "Cantabria" • M-Bsp (Alt+Backspace) deletes a word backwards, like in Bash. • M-[ has become bindable. (Be careful, though: as it is the starting combination of many escape sequences, avoid gluing it together with other keystrokes, like in a macro.) • With --indicator and --softwrap, the first keystroke in an empty buffer does not crash. • Invoking the formatter while text is marked does not crash. • In UTF-8 locales, an anchor is shown as a diamond. 2020.07.29 - GNU nano 5.0 "Among the fields of barley" • With --indicator (or -q or 'set indicator') nano will show a kind of scrollbar on the righthand side of the screen to indicate where in the buffer the viewport is located and how much it covers. • With <Alt+Insert> any line can be "tagged" with an anchor, and <Alt+PageUp> and <Alt+PageDown> will jump to the nearest anchor. When using line numbers, an anchor is shown as "+" in the margin. • The Execute Command prompt is now directly accessible from the main menu (with ^T, replacing the Spell Checker). The Linter, Formatter, Spell Checker, Full Justification, Suspension, and Cut-Till-End functions are available in this menu too. • On terminals that support at least 256 colors, nine new color names are available: pink, purple, mauve, lagoon, mint, lime, peach, orange, and latte. These do not have lighter versions. • For the color names red, green, blue, yellow, cyan, magenta, white, and black, the prefix 'light' gives a brighter color. Prefix 'bright' is deprecated, as it means both bold AND light. • All color names can be preceded with "bold," and/or "italic," (in that order) to get a bold and/or italic typeface. • With --bookstyle (or -O or 'set bookstyle') nano considers any line that begins with whitespace as the start of a paragraph. • Refreshing the screen with ^L now works in every menu. • In the main menu, ^L also centers the line with the cursor. • Toggling the help lines with M-X now works in all menus except in the help viewer and the linter. • At a filename prompt, the first <Tab> lists the possibilities, and these are listed near the bottom instead of near the top. • Bindable function 'curpos' has been renamed to 'location'. • Long option --tempfile has been renamed to --saveonexit. • Short option -S is now a synonym of --softwrap. • The New Buffer toggle (M-F) has become non-persistent. Options --multibuffer and 'set multibuffer' still make it default to on. • Backup files will retain their group ownership (when possible). • Data is synced to disk before "... lines written" is shown. • The raw escape sequences for F13 to F16 are no longer recognized. • Distro-specific syntaxes, and syntaxes of less common languages, have been moved down to subdirectory syntax/extra/. The affected distros and others may wish to move wanted syntaxes one level up. • Syntaxes for Markdown, Haskell, and Ada were added.

GNU Emacs is an extensible, customizable editor textand more. At its core is an interpreter for Emacs Lisp, a dialect of the Lisp programming language with extensions to support text editing. The features of GNU Emacs include: - Content-sensitive editing modes, including syntax coloring, for a wide variety of file types including plain text, source code, and HTML. - Complete built-in documentation, including a tutorial for new users. - Support for many languages and their scripts, including all scripts, Russian, Greek, Japanese, Chinese, Korean, Thai, Vietnamese, Lao, Ethiopian, and some Indian scripts. - Highly customizable, using Emacs Lisp code or a graphical customization interface. - A large number of extensions that add other functionality, including a project planner, mail and news reader, debugger interface, calendar, and more. Many of these extensions are distributed with GNU Emacs; others are available separately. This package contains Emacs version 27.
